Javier Hernandez Tells Women to ‘Maintain the Home’ and Embrace Traditional Roles

The former Mexico striker has faced intense social media criticism after posting two Instagram videos arguing that women are eroding masculinity

Overview

  • On July 17, Hernandez questioned why household chores are considered “patriarchal oppression” in an Instagram video that drew early criticism.
  • The next day he urged women to “embrace your feminine energy” by nurturing, multiplying, cleaning and maintaining the home, warning that society was eroding masculinity.
  • His posts have prompted widespread backlash online, with fans and commentators denouncing his comments as outdated and sexist.
  • Hernandez has not issued a public apology and continues training with Liga MX side Guadalajara despite the backlash.
  • The 37-year-old Mexico all-time leading scorer split from his wife Sarah Kohan in 2021 and has cited personal and philosophical reflections during his reduced playing time.
